An Invitation to Learning & Business Colleagues:

 

AI & Learning LAB + Briefing
Location: Saratoga Springs, NY USA

May 17 & 18, 2023 – Elliott Masie, Host

 

In a Nutshell: "Let's spend 2 days exploring how AI, Generative AI, Content Curation AI, Augmented Media and other emerging technologies may change, enhance, extend, replace or disrupt workplace learning."

 

AI is a provocative and also controversial force in the world of technology, business and education. Elliott Masie has created an interactive and experiential small event to help learning professionals better understand and imagine how learning organizations, business units and learners themselves will evolve learning processes with the rapidly expanding set of AI tools, systems and strategies. 

 

Below is the "mind-map" of the activities, experiments and conversations we will have in Saratoga Springs. The LAB is designed for both colleagues that are brand new to the AI world --- as well as people experienced with AI tools and strategies. We will help each participant use AI to imagine creating, curating, delivering and evolving learning activities. And, since the world of AI is changing on a weekly basis, we will gather by video in June, July and August to track changes in the field as well as your own projects.

Together, We Will Explore These AI & Learning Impacts in the LAB:

 

  • How Learning Designers Might Leverage AI

  • How Employees Themselves Might Use AI for Learning

  • How AI Might Become the Curation Tool of Choice

  • A-Learning: Augmented Learning with AI

  • When AI Is Inaccurate, Dangerous, Risky or Worse

  • Personalization with AI

  • AI & Needs Analysis, Assessment, Testing & Simulation

  • AI for Workflow Support, Nudging 

  • Rights & Use Licensing for AI Content

  • Can AI Do Graphic Creation for Learning Resources

  • Coaching with AI?

  • Creating an Internal Content "Cave"

  • Global Translation - Using AI for Language

  • Is AI Supportive of Diversity & Inclusion

  • The Role of Collaborative/Cohort Learning with AI

  • Virtual Instructors and Digital Twins via AI

  • Brain Science and AI: Research & Philosophies

  • AI & LMS/Learning/Talent Systems: Pathways Forward

  • Impact of AI on Learner Skills & Motivation

  • New Skills for Learning & Development Professionals

  • Job and Role Changes with AI in Learning & Business

  • Your Questions, Concerns, Challenges & Projects

Faculty:

 

 

 

Elliott Masie is the host and facilitator for the AI & Learning LAB + Briefing.    Elliott brings over 50 years experience in the learning and technology fields.  He is credited with being one of the innovators for the start of eLearning in the 1990’s and has led global conferences on Learning and Technology for over 30 years. Elliott is the author of 12 books and is the Chair of the MASIE Learning Foundation and MASIE Learning Collaborative with 75 global corporate members. In addition, MASIE Productions is a TONY-Nominated producing partner of 40 Broadway shows including: Kinky Boots, Allegiance, Funny Girl, The Piano Lesson, SpongeBob and more. For a longer bio about Elliott Masie, click here!

 

Elliott will be joined by a range of AI and Learning resources – who will join us either in person in Saratoga or engage with the group by interactive video. These include Richard Culatta (education and technology leader), Andrea Wong (user experience researcher) and several CLO’s and tech leaders.
